In the matter of The Companies Ordin-
ance, 1932
and of
THE SOUTH CHINA MOTORSHIP BUILDING & REPAIRING WORKS, LTD.
(Creditors Voluntary Winding-up).
NOTICE is hereby given that the Final
Meeting of Creditors of the above- named Company will be held at the office of Messrs. Lowe, Bingham & Matthews, 7 Queen's Road Central, Hong Kong, on Thursday, 31st January, 1935, at 12.30 p.m. precisely, for the purpose of having the Accounts of the liquida- tors, showing the manner in which the wind- ing-up has been conducted and the property of the Company disposed of, laid before such Meeting and of hearing any explanation that may be given by the liquidators.
JOHN FLEMING, c.a. E. M. BRYDEN, 0... Liquidators.
Hong Kong, 28th December, 1934.

(FILE No. 440 of 1934) TRADE MARKS ORDINANCE, 1909
Application for Registration of a Trade Mark.
N
OTICE is hereby given that Kwan Sin
Tack Tong Iharmacy, (MKB
) of No. 123, Thomson Road, (ground floor), Victoria, in the Colony of Hog Kong, have, on the 19th day of October, 1934, applied for the registration in Hong Kong, in the Register of Trade Marks, of the following Trade Mark, a facsimile of which is shewn hereunder :--
堂酒
AE
in the name of the Kwan Sin Tack Tong Pharmacy, who claim to be the proprietors thereof.
The Trade Mark has been used by the Ap- plicants in respect of Medicinal Plaster since 1911 in Class 3.
Facsimiles of such Trade Mark can be seen at the office of the Registrar of Trade Marks and also at the offices of the undersigned.
Dated the 26th day of October, 1934.
LEO D'ALMADA & CO., Solicitors for the Applicants,
1st floor, David House,
Hong Kong.
